Carillon - Saint-Pie-X

Located within the Greater Montreal metropolitan area, Carillon - Saint-Pie-X is a neighbourhood in Longueuil, Quebec.

Transportation

Carillon - Saint-Pie-X offers homeowners the choice between several modes of transportation. The fairly good transit infrastructure allows people to get to many destinations without needing a vehicle. Homeowners benefit from approximately 40 bus lines, and the closest bus stop is generally very close by. It is also convenient for pedestrians to move around in this neighbourhood; many common errands can be run without the use of a vehicle. Carillon - Saint-Pie-X will appeal to active house buyers since it is suitable for bicycling. For instance, it is an even ride to most destinations, and there are a good number of bike lanes.

Services

House buyers in Carillon - Saint-Pie-X will value that a grocery store is always only a short walk away. Additionally, a restaurant is usually just around the corner, and there are also a few cafes in this area. A decent variety of clothing stores is also available within a reasonably short walking distance. When it comes to education, in Carillon - Saint-Pie-X, families will typically be able to access daycares and schools by walking.

Character

Despite the somewhat busy feel, there are a lot of green spaces to enjoy in Carillon - Saint-Pie-X. To be more precise, most locations within the neighbourhood have fairly good access to public green spaces, like Parc Laurier and Parc Lecavalier, since there are around 20 of them nearby for residents to check out. Despite the abundance of parks, most streets have sub-par tree coverage. This neighbourhood has many sections that are very calm and quiet, although other spots can be noisy, especially.

Housing

Renters occupy around three quarters of the units in the neighbourhood whereas owners occupy the remainder. Small apartment buildings are the predominant housing type, representing many buildings in this part of the city, while the remainder are mainly duplexes and single detached homes. About 45% of properties in this part of Longueuil were built in the 1960s and 1970s, while most of the remaining buildings were constructed pre-1960 and in the 1980s. This neighbourhood offers mainly three bedroom and two bedroom homes.
